According to the report of Civil Registration System CRS, Registration of birth is a right of every child and it is the first step towards establishing her/his legal identity. It is necessary to give an account of births and deaths to the Registrar of Births and Deaths under the Registration of Births and Deaths Act 1969. Also, they are registered only at the place of their occurrence. Based on information received from 34 States/UTs, the share of institutional births to total registered births is 73.7% according to the overview report of the CRS.

Importance of Birth Certificate Translation

  1. Immigration Purposes

Most of the countries require translated birth certificates as proof for establishing a person’s identity and judging their eligibility for residency or citizenship within the country. Facilitating the verification of their credentials, enables them to acquire social services like healthcare, getting a passport, receiving credit, opening of bank account, and healthcare. In a world threatened by rising risks of terrorism and crime, accurate verification becomes critical for the safety of the residents of any nation.

  1. Legal Authentication

This credential is essential for legal authentication purposes like marriage, adoption, and inheritance. It becomes crucial to prove your age and identity legally to the country you are moving in, as translated certificates are needed to validate relationships and comply with regulatory frameworks across borders. Failure to provide these documents may result in delays or rejection of applications. When a certain person migrates to a different country and wants to settle and get married over there, the conversion of this document becomes essential in proving his credibility.

  1. Overseas education

Students desiring to receive their higher education overseas require all of their documents translated into the language of the country they want to visit as part of their application process. These documents are used in educational institutions and other organizations to verify the applicant’s identity and cross-check with his academic, legal, and civic background.These required papers often contain specialized terms and formats that may differ from country to country. Translators experienced in legal terminology are required to provide accurate translations that comply with the regulatory requirements.

Deficiency in producing these documents may result in delays, or altogether cancellation of the student’s application.

How to acquire a Translated Birth Certificate

1. Find a reputable service provider

Start the process by researching good translation companies who are specialized in legal document translations including birth certificates and other official documents.

2. Provide necessary information

It’s important you provide a clear copy of your original birth certificate. You may add additional instructions like specific formatting, or title change if needed.

3. Communicate the target language

You must specify the target language in which you need your translation so that it meets the requirements of the intended institution.

4. Review and Approve

Once the translation is finished, you must review it carefully to ensure that names, dates and, other details match with your original document so that it can be finalized for production.

5. Receive certificate of accuracy

Once the document is approved you will receive your translated document along with a certificate of accuracy guaranteeing to the correctness of translation which might be required for official purposes.
